The courthouse was built in 1888 in the French Neo-Barogue style which was very popular then. The renovated facility was transferred to Indiana State University in 2006 for school use and historical tours.
The white memorial in the center of the picture is the Soldiers and Sailors (Civil War) Monument on the NE side of the Vigo County Courthouse.
The 1920's photograph observed in the lobby of the Drury Inn south at I-65 Exit 7. The current picture was taken across busy 3rd Street (US41). Have roughly the same spot as the figure at the top of the Civil War monument is observed about the same place relative to the courthouse dome.
